Dhaka: The Election Commission (EC) has called on voters registered through the ‘Postal Vote BD’ mobile app to complete their voting process promptly and ensure submission of their votes by February 10. This request is directed towards those residing in Bangladesh and participating in the national elections and referendum.



According to Bangladesh Sangbad Sangstha, the EC has emphasized the importance of voters submitting their yellow envelopes to the nearest post office by the specified deadline to ensure timely delivery to the Returning Officer. The Commission highlighted that ballots must be completed immediately upon receipt to meet this deadline.



In an earlier statement, the EC also advised all registered postal voters to scan the QR code on their envelopes by February 10 at 11:59 PM Bangladesh time. The Commission warned that failure to scan the QR code would result in ballots being deemed invalid, stressing the necessity of adhering to this requirement to ensure votes are counted.
